Transaction 95fd8e8caf5fd61cb665578f1394f531156d1268733c6eaec5102c30a3edcd36
1 Input
1 Output
-
95fd8e8caf5fd61cb665578f1394f531156d1268733c6eaec5102c30a3edcd36:0
- value
- 1796976
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 72258132b25934b46a593638ab1761c70efffe75 OP_EQUAL
- address
- 3C6ZtHP8zGYrufjkC24xLFP6U6RjzU6jP6